Public Sector | AJOFM Sibiu
As part of the National Agency for Employment, the County Agencies for Employment (AJOFM) provide
employment services for the Romanian labour market, significantly contributing to the increase of the
number of employees.
Facing long walk-in office waiting lines and piles of printed paper, AJOFM sought to improve the
efficiency of the administrative procedures for both citizens as well as public institutions. Therefore
AJOFM needed a way to streamline operations and provide citizens with a higher quality of service.
Achieving immediate and flexible service delivery implied creating a dynamic and powerful web-based
platform.

Software Services Case Study
Starting with the consultancy and concept
architecture, iQuest developed an application
that provides self-service platforms for five
County Agencies in Romania: Sibiu, Satu-Mare,
Hunedoara, Dambovita and Vaslui, upholding
the shift towards a full set of e-Government
services.
The web-based system enables users to access
the portal from a device of their choice:
personal computer, mobile phones or one of
the new 43 touch screens installed at agency
locations. The app’s distinctive services target
several groups of users, guided and
counselled through nine units: My Account, e-
Urn, e-Info, Alerts, e-Scholarship, e-
References, e-Employment, Electronic Visa,
Control Panel.
By integrating the system with the text-to-
speech technology developed by iQuest, we
obtained a complex and user-centric platform
that eased the communication process with
end users.
The specialised modules have been developed
in an open source framework, to build an
interoperable, authenticated and secure portal,
by addressing all aspects of security including
people, processes, technology and content.

Founded in 1992 and headquartered in Bucharest, Romania, the County Agencies for Employment are decentralised
territorial structures that operate as part of The Romanian National Agency for Employment.
With 42 County Agencies AJOFM increases employment through policies and programs implemented and
coordinated on the regional labour market.
